首页
/ 解决Play Integrity验证失败:2025年PlayIntegrityFix工具全面部署指南

解决Play Integrity验证失败:2025年PlayIntegrityFix工具全面部署指南

2026-04-12 09:32:09作者:幸俭卉

为什么Play Integrity验证如此重要?

当你打开Google Play商店却看到"设备未认证"提示,或尝试使用金融类应用时遭遇功能限制,这很可能是Play Integrity验证失败所致。2025年,Google进一步强化了设备验证机制,导致大量Root设备面临应用兼容性问题。PlayIntegrityFix作为目前最有效的解决方案,通过智能修改系统属性和设备标识,帮助Root用户重新获得完整的Google服务访问权限。

核心价值:让Root设备重获完整服务

PlayIntegrityFix的核心优势在于其双向适配能力:既能够模拟通过Google的严格验证机制,又不会影响设备的Root功能和自定义特性。具体而言,它能够:

  • 修复"设备未认证"状态,恢复应用商店正常功能
  • 解决金融类应用的安全检测问题
  • 保持系统Root状态的同时通过完整性验证
  • 兼容Android 8.0至Android 16 Beta的广泛设备范围

5步完成环境配置:从检查到验证

准备阶段:环境适配检测

在开始部署前,请确认你的设备满足以下条件:

系统要求 具体参数 验证方法
Android版本 8.0及以上 设置 > 关于手机 > Android版本
Root环境 Magisk/KernelSU/APatch 检查对应管理应用状态
Zygisk支持 已启用 Magisk设置中确认Zygisk开关打开

快速验证脚本

# 检查Android SDK版本(需26及以上)
if [ "$(getprop ro.build.version.sdk)" -lt 26 ]; then
  echo "❌ 设备不兼容:需要Android 8.0及以上版本"
  exit 1
fi

# 检查Magisk环境
if ! command -v magisk &> /dev/null; then
  echo "⚠️ 未检测到Magisk,可能影响模块功能"
fi

执行阶段:分步骤安装流程

步骤1:获取项目代码

git clone https://gitcode.com/GitHub_Trending/pl/PlayIntegrityFix
cd PlayIntegrityFix

步骤2:模块构建

# 构建发布版本
./gradlew assembleRelease

步骤3:Magisk模块安装

  1. 打开Magisk应用,切换到"模块"标签
  2. 点击"从本地安装",导航至项目目录
  3. 选择app/build/outputs/apk/release/目录下的APK文件
  4. 滑动确认安装,等待进度完成
  5. 点击"立即重启"使模块生效

⚠️ 重要警告:绝对不要在Recovery模式中刷入此模块!安装过程必须在正常系统中通过Magisk应用完成,否则可能导致系统不稳定。

验证阶段:确认安装状态

设备重启后,执行以下命令验证安装结果:

# 检查模块是否正确加载
if [ -d "/data/adb/modules/playintegrityfix" ]; then
  echo "✅ 模块安装成功"
  # 检查关键文件
  if [ -f "/data/adb/modules/playintegrityfix/pif.json" ]; then
    echo "✅ 配置文件存在"
  else
    echo "⚠️ 配置文件缺失,可能需要重新安装"
  fi
else
  echo "❌ 模块安装失败,请检查Magisk日志"
fi

深度优化:个性化设备标识配置

配置参数说明表

PlayIntegrityFix通过pif.json文件实现设备信息自定义,核心参数如下:

参数名称 作用 示例值
FINGERPRINT 设备指纹标识 "google/oriole_beta/oriole:16/BP22.250325.012/13467521:user/release-keys"
MANUFACTURER 设备制造商 "Google"
MODEL 设备型号 "Pixel 6"
SECURITY_PATCH 安全补丁日期 "2025-04-05"

配置修改步骤

  1. 定位配置文件:/data/adb/modules/playintegrityfix/pif.json
  2. 使用文件管理器或终端编辑:
nano /data/adb/modules/playintegrityfix/pif.json
  1. 修改参数后保存,执行以下命令应用更改:
# 重启Zygisk使配置生效
killall zygiskd

风险提示

  • 修改设备标识可能导致部分应用功能异常
  • 过于陈旧的安全补丁日期会触发Google安全警告
  • 建议使用知名品牌设备的真实指纹信息,减少被检测风险
  • 修改前请备份原始配置文件:cp pif.json pif.json.bak

常见问题解决方案

安装后设备无法启动

解决方法

  1. 进入恢复模式
  2. 执行命令删除模块:rm -rf /data/adb/modules/playintegrityfix
  3. 重启设备,重新安装兼容版本

Play商店仍显示未认证

解决方法

# 清除Google服务数据
am force-stop com.google.android.gms
pm clear com.google.android.gms

# 清除Play商店数据
am force-stop com.android.vending
pm clear com.android.vending

# 重启设备
reboot

Android 13+验证失败

解决方法: 需额外安装TrickyStore模块并配置有效keybox文件:

  1. 从可靠来源获取TrickyStore模块
  2. 放置keybox文件到/data/adb/keybox/目录
  3. 重启设备后重新验证

使用建议与最佳实践

日常维护指南

  • 定期更新:Google持续更新验证机制,建议每月执行一次更新:
cd PlayIntegrityFix
git pull
./gradlew assembleRelease
  • 备份配置:每次更新前备份pif.json文件,避免自定义配置丢失

  • 状态监控:安装"Play Integrity API Checker"应用,每周检查验证状态

2025年使用要点

  • Android 16 Beta用户需使用最新开发版模块
  • 避免同时使用多个Play Integrity修复类模块
  • 遇到验证失败时,优先检查Play服务版本是否为最新
  • 对于三星设备,建议配合GalaxyStoreFix模块使用

通过本指南,你已掌握PlayIntegrityFix的完整部署流程和优化技巧。记住,保持软件更新、正确配置设备标识、定期验证状态是确保长期稳定使用的关键。如有问题,可查阅项目文档或社区讨论获取最新解决方案。

登录后查看全文
热门项目推荐
相关项目推荐